Recognizing Signs of Daycare Negligence

Recognizing signs of daycare negligence is a vital task for parents and guardians, as it can help prevent potential harm to their children. Daycare centers are required to maintain safe environments, ensure proper supervision, and adhere to specific care standards. Negligence occurs when a daycare fails to meet these obligations, leading to injuries or emotional trauma for children in their care.
Common signs of daycare negligence include unexplained injuries, consistent sleep disruptions, changes in appetite, withdrawal from peers, or unusual behavior post-daycare. For instance, a child frequently reporting pain or discomfort after spending time at a specific center might indicate physical abuse or neglect. If you suspect any form of mistreatment, document incidents, take photos of injuries (if safe to do so), and maintain a log of unusual behavior.
